Back on the evening of 09/17 I downloaded the Workstation Live beta 1.3 ISO, and ran the check sum (ok), and burned it to a DVD. I used the DVD to make a bare metal clean install on my test machine (Lenovo M58P with E8400 processor) The media check and Anaconda ran fine. The install went flawlessly. After a restart, I decided to wait until morning to start testing. Nothing was left running overnight, I just let the screen lock time out and left it. In the morning (09/18) I found the fan in the test machine running full speed, then it started to slow down, but not to its usual idle speed. I logged in and started the system monitor and found that core 0 was at 100% all the time and core 1 was cycling between a few percent and 100%. When core 1 was at 100% the fan would naturally run faster.
